Abstract :
Electronic tongues (ETs) based on potentiometric sensor arrays are often used for foodstuff classification, origin recognition, estimation of complex samples´ properties, etc. In the last few years they were also applied for fermentation monitoring, as a devices capable of fast, inexpensive, automated and on-line control of the process. In this work a novel application for ET is proposed - miniaturized flow-through sensor array was used for classification of samples obtained during anaerobic digestion of whey in sequence bioreactor.
